Q: Is 101,213,129 a Composite Number?
A: No, 101,213,129 is not a composite number; it is a prime number.
The number 101,213,129 can be evenly divided by 1 and 101,213,129, with no remainder.
Since 101,213,129 can be divided by just 1 and 101,213,129, it is not a composite number.
